What is the meaning of munchkin?
Definition
noun (English)
1. (informal) A child.Examples: "Picture this: your child begins his first day of group childcare, and he is suddenly surrounded by other munchkins his age […]"Synonyms: childinformal
2. (informal) A person of very short stature.Examples: "It'll also have a keyboard configured for a munchkin (...)"Synonyms: dwarf, lilliputian, pygmy, tiddlerinformal
3. (roleplaying games) A player who mainly concentrates on increasing their character's power and capabilities.Examples: "Doesn't anybody recognize humor anymore, or have our faces gone completely stiff from thinking about good vs. evil or character balance or munchkin-zapping?"; "Munchkinism is similar to "Monty Haul" gaming; however it involves playing at incredible power levels purely for the sake of watching the terrain get blown away by player characters who are unstoppable. Munchkinism also involves "rules rape," wherein players milk every advantage out of the rules. Often a munchkin will carry a favorite character from game to game, usually with the maximum allowable ability scores, skill ratings, etc - and enough hardware/magic to destroy the planet four times over."; "younger gamers of a power-oriented mindset .. an immature power-gamer who has +10 Swords of Slay Anything for wallpaper. It derives from those Oz denizines, Munchkins, to young gamers who often go in for hack'n'slash Monty Hauls, to anyone who seems more concerned with Winning (usually by killing anything that stands in his path) than with playing a game with other people."
4. (informal, slang) Synonym of donut hole (“ball-shaped pastry”) (genericization of the Dunkin' trademark "Munchkins")Synonyms: donut holeinformalslang
5. (informal) A pet name one uses for something adorable like a pet, child, or a romantic partnerinformal
